> I'm trying to use the Display Tag Library (http://displaytag.sourceforge.net/) and 
> am 
> having some trouble getting it working. This is my first time using a tag library 
outside 
> the standard, so I'm wondering where I may have messed up.
> 
> Here is my code:
> 
> <sql:query var="techs">
>       SELECT technology_id, technology_name
>       FROM technology_types
>       ORDER BY technology_name
> </sql:query>
> 
> <display:table name="${techs.rows}" />
> 
> And here is my error:
> 
> javax.servlet.ServletException: You do not appear to have the Commons Lang library, 
> version 2.  commons-lang-2.jar is available in the displaytag distribution, or from 
> the 
> Jakarta website at http://jakarta.apache.org/commons .
> 
> Odd thing is, I checked and the commons-lang-2.jar file is located in the 
> /common/lib 
> directory. It was installed by default with Tomcat 5.0.19. I've followed all the 
> instructions on the displaytag website for installing the taglib. I'm using the EL 
> version of the displaytag library. The displaytag.tld file is located in my WEB-INF 
> folder. The displaytag.jar is located in my WEB-INF/lib folder. I've restarted 
> tomcat 
and 
> everything else in my web application works perfectly fine.
> 
> Anyone help?
